Original Description
The painting First Swim by Dutch artist David Adolph Constant Artz captures a tender, fleeting moment of childhood innocence. Set against a softly blurred lakeside backdrop, the work depicts a young boy hesitantly stepping into shallow water, his posture poised between curiosity and caution. Painted in 1881, this masterpiece exemplifies the Hague School's signature style—naturalistic yet intimate, with loose brushwork that evokes the play of light on water and skin. Artz, influenced by his mentor Jozef Israëls, specialized in genre scenes of peasant life and children, rendered with warm tonalities and psychological depth. Historically, First Swim represents the 19th-century European shift toward realism infused with emotional resonance, bridging the gap between academic precision and Impressionist spontaneity. Its enduring appeal lies in its universal theme of youthful discovery, making it a cherished example of Dutch Golden Age-influenced realism.
